Transaction 21a7f762762eb4261dd876c2d0e1d38e4931ec1b6ab7c2aa921b6676b6dfe149
1 Input
1 Output
-
21a7f762762eb4261dd876c2d0e1d38e4931ec1b6ab7c2aa921b6676b6dfe149:0
- value
- 16724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db7ad642ba070bf115e5292fae057324d0cb719 OP_EQUAL
- address
- 3QpYvCZGk3Jh1ynzyq73uwzugcASiqTn3N